Now I’m worried about mine being too fat. Is a approximately six to seven pound barred rock too heavy?
Seriously - if you're worried, pick her up in both hands - one hand on each side. Feel along her keel - the breastbone along the front. It should feel pretty smooth from one side of her chest to the other. If the bone is prominent, as in, you can pinch it between your fingers, she's skinny. If you feel cleavage ... she's overweight. For laying hens, you want her somewhere in between.
